Peter
Maheu
As Managing Member of Global Intelligence Network, Peter founded
the company in 1996 to assist the Las Vegas gaming industry in their
regulatory compliance programs. He established methodology for investigations
in the international arena for both investigations of various industries
and emerging markets.

Noel
Krieger
Coming on board with Global in 1999, Noel was made Director of Operations
in 2002, and oversees all aspects of domestic and international
investigations, in addition to special operations. Noel has developed
an extensive base of sources throughout the world and examined the
viability of emerging markets worldwide.

Chuck
Kenerson
Chuck spent his youth on the East Coast and moved to Las Vegas in
1961. He graduated from High School in Las Vegas, and graduated
from UNLV in 1970. Chuck joined Global in 2000, bringing years of
experience with the DEA and Nevada Gaming Control Board. Chuck was
instrumental in establishing Global's mystery shopping Division,
QSI Specialists, the largest mystery shopping company in Nevada.
